Chcete-li deklarovat (vytvořit) proměnnou, určíte typ, ponecháte alespoň jedno místo, poté název proměnné a řádek ukončíte středníkem (;). Java používá klíčové slovo int pro celé číslo, double pro číslo s plovoucí desetinnou čárkou (číslo s dvojitou přesností) a boolean pro logickou hodnotu (true nebo false).
Když deklarujete proměnnou, měli byste ji také inicializovat. Existují dva typy inicializace proměnných: explicitní a implicitní. Proměnné jsou explicitně inicializovány, pokud jim je v prohlášení deklarována hodnota. Implicitní inicializace nastane, když je proměnným během zpracování přiřazena hodnota.
Deklarace (vytváření) proměnných
proměnná typu = hodnota; Where type is one of C ++ types (such as int), and variable is the name of the variable (such as x or myName). Znaménko rovná se používá k přiřazení hodnot proměnné.
Níže je uvedena základní syntaxe pro deklaraci řetězce. char str_name [velikost]; Ve výše uvedené syntaxi str_name je libovolný název daný proměnné řetězce a velikost je použita k definování délky řetězce, i.e počet znaků, které řetězce uloží.
Názvy proměnných byste měli vždy začínat písmenem. V názvech proměnných můžete použít písmena, číslice a podtržítka. Měli byste pojmenovat své proměnné tak, aby popisovaly hodnoty, které ukládají. Při pojmenovávání proměnných byste neměli zahrnout určitá vyhrazená slova, například If, For a Then.
Deklarace proměnných
Před jejich použitím je nutné deklarovat všechny proměnné. Deklarace proměnné znamená definování jejího typu a volitelně nastavení počáteční hodnoty (inicializace proměnné). ... Proměnné se převrátí, když uložená hodnota překročí prostor určený k jejímu uložení. Níže je uveden příklad.
Jaký je rozdíl mezi inicializací a přiřazením? Inicializace dává proměnné počáteční hodnotu v okamžiku, kdy je vytvořena. Přiřazení dává proměnné hodnotu v určitém okamžiku po vytvoření proměnné.
Vytvořte pole
Pole se používají k ukládání více hodnot do jedné proměnné, místo deklarování samostatných proměnných pro každou hodnotu. Chcete-li deklarovat pole, definujte typ proměnné v hranatých závorkách: string [] cars; Nyní jsme deklarovali proměnnou, která obsahuje pole řetězců.
Obecná forma deklarace řetězcové proměnné je:
Deklarace určuje jedinečný název entity spolu s informacemi o jejím typu a dalších charakteristikách. V C ++ je bod, ve kterém je deklarován název, bod, ve kterém se stane viditelným pro kompilátor.
Proměnnou můžete definovat jako celé číslo a přiřadit jí hodnotu v jediné deklaraci. Například: int age = 10; V tomto příkladu by proměnná s názvem age byla definována jako celé číslo a byla by jí přiřazena hodnota 10.
Typická deklarace pro pole v C ++ je: type name [elements]; kde typ je platný typ (například int, float ...), name je platný identifikátor a pole elements (které je vždy uzavřeno v hranatých závorkách []), určuje velikost pole.
Zatím žádné komentáře